Kunice is a municipality and village in Prague-East District in the Central Bohemian Region of the Czech Republic. It has about 1,700 inhabitants.
Administrative parts[]
Villages of Dolní Lomnice, Horní Lomnice, Vidovice and Všešímy are administrative parts of Kunice.
